    This review is written to aid potential court reporting students in their search for a school to…read moreattend. This is probably the most affordable court reporting school in SoCal. A couple of years ago the school was able to offer financial aid to their students such as me. In my years as a student here, the program has gone through some radical changes. The school has become a hybrid online and on-campus program. Many students are now distance learners and are able to be a part of the program from home through recorded classes and Zoom meetings. All of the academic classes (English, legal and medical terminology, software classes) are done online. We now have an online platform to practice on called RealTimeCoach (RTC) to perfect our skills and to log practice hours. Live English classes and a few other classes are recorded for playback for the students' benefit. I was really shocked to learn that there are other schools in the area that don't provide extensive software training like we do! Editing and preparing a transcript are a HUGE part of our career and learning these skills before graduation is essential. We have three different software classes and also receive in-person guidance when needed. Overall, I've enjoyed going to school here. There is a great sense of community and everyone here looks out for each other. We have had great real-life experience from our new program director, Shannon. She has been extremely open to providing anything that the students have needed in order to succeed. The program continues to flourish and implement positive changes every semester. I am nearing the end of my time here at Tri-Community and I am happy I picked this program.
